一般ユーザでログインした場合と、root でログインした場合の PATH の違い により、shutdown などのコマンドが別物を実行することになっていることは ご存知でしょうか。 パスを指定せず shutdown と打った場合、 一般ユーザでは /usr/bin/shutdown root では /sbin/shutdown を呼び出すことになります。 From: 田村修二 Subject: [vine-users:076265] 電源が自動シャットダウンしない Date: Wed, 28 Feb 2007 14:18:00 +0900 > Vine3.2 から Vine4.1 にクリーンインストールにて > 乗り換えました。機種は、IBM ThinkPad R40e です。 > > コンソールからログイン、startx にて Gnome を使用 > しています。 > > ログアウト後、root権限にて shutdown -h now した > 場合、電源が自動シャットダウンしません。電源ボタン > 押下するとすぐにコンソール画面が消え、さらに押下し > つづけると電源が落ちます。 「ログアウト後、root権限にて」というのは、GNOME デスクトップを終了して コンソールからもログアウトして root でログインしなおすということでしょ うか。 もし、GNOME デスクトップを終了してコンソールからはログアウトせず一般ユー ザから su を使ってということだと、su - にしないと /usr/bin/shutdown を 実行していることになると思います。 -- 森口